Some entertainment companies have contractual clauses that bar their artistes from dating.
But Korean entertainment company, YG Entertainment, the company behind popular K-pop acts 2NE1 and Big Bang, has taken the unusual step of introducing a contractual clause to bar members of its upcoming girl group from going under the knife, reported Korean media.
“We are focusing on forming a group that emphasizes natural beauty.
“The new girl group consists of members who have not had cosmetic surgery and have agreed to a clause which bars them from undergoing cosmetic procedures, in their contract with YG Entertainment CEO Yang Hyun Suk,” said a YG Entertainment spokesperson.
“The trainees for this girl group are teens aged between 15 and 19 … that’s why we introduced the ‘no cosmetic surgery’ clause in their contract.”
The spokesperson added that “cosmetic surgery has its good points” but may obscure the artiste’s “natural charms”.
YG Entertainment had previously introduced such a clause in its employment contract with Korean singing quartet Big Mama.
However, this is the first time members of a K-pop idol girl group will have such a clause in theirs.
YG Entertainment’s new girl group will have between five to seven members and are expected to debut early next year.
